Lapidius: Book 1 (A Nation Found Series) by Matthew Runals – Review by Kerry Carr

LapidiusLapidius by Matthew Runals
My rating: 4 of 5 stars

This is the first book in A Nation Found Series and the first book I have read by this author. This is a YA adult fantasy adventure which has so much happening that it will keep you on the edge of your seat.
I wasn’t too sure what to expect going into this book however I was not disappointed. The author opens us up to a world where it seems all hope is lost until the youth are given something to fight for. The characters is the book are well written and I loved how the boys had banter between themselves just as you know that boys do in real life. Every aspect of this book was well thoughtout out and the characters and surroundings were brought to life.

Joey and his friends and their family’s are struggling to survive as times are hard and their town is losing all hope.
To save their son’s, Joey and his friends are sent to Lapidius. Lapidius is a school where the boys will be educated and feed well.
However things aren’t all that they seem and when they arrive the boys realise the Lapidius is more of a training camp that a school and they are being trained to fight a war that gets closer by the day.
Add to this all the mystery that surrounds Lapidius, the monsters and the adventures that Joey and his friends find themselves on and this becomes one book that you will not be able to put down.
